What were the political differences between the Union and Confederacy?

The main political difference between the Union and Confederacy was over the issue of states' rights versus federal authority. The Confederacy believed in the sovereignty of individual states and their right to secede from the Union, while the Union believed in a strong federal government and the preservation of the Union. This fundamental difference ultimately led to the Civil War.

What was the difference between how the union and confederacy named battles s?

The Union named the battles after the nearest water-course (eg Bull Run, Antietam, Stones River). The Confederacy named them after the nearest town (eg Manassas, Sharpsburg, Murfreesboro).

What were the main differences between the draft laws of the Union and the Confederacy?

There were two major difference between the draft laws of the Confederacy and the Union. They differed in these ways:A. In the Union, a citizen who was drafted did not have to serve if they could pay the Government $300 or find a person to replace himself;B. In the Confederacy, a person was subject to the draft unless they owned 20 or more slaves.Those are the major differences. Ages of eligibility in the South was expanded later on.
